Here is what we actually do on a Palm Beach Gardens fireplace maintenance. We clean the firebox and glass, service the damper, check the draft and gasket seals, and inspect the firebrick and venting — a short visit that keeps the unit reliable through long idle stretches and short, occasional use. Why Palm Beach Gardens homes need fireplace maintenance done right
Routine maintenance keeps the firebox, damper, and venting working as a system, catching the small wear that otherwise becomes a no-heat or smoke-back problem at the worst time.
Incorporated in 1959 well west of the Intracoastal, Palm Beach Gardens is largely inland, so its chimneys contend with high humidity and seasonal storm-driven rain rather than direct salt spray, making cap, crown, and flashing integrity the main maintenance concern across its 1960s-to-modern housing stock. What a lasting fireplace maintenance in Palm Beach Gardens has to account for — around PGA National and PGA National Resort and the surrounding golf-club communities — is the housing itself: 1960s onward, ranging from mid-century homes founded by John D. MacArthur in 1959 to 1980s-2000s gated-community estates, mostly block-and-stucco with prefab or masonry fireplaces.
